Introduction – A Legend Reborn

Bugatti was once the crown jewel of European automotive luxury and speed in the early 20th century, but after the death of founder Ettore Bugatti in 1947, the marque faded into history. Over the next six decades, the name would surface sporadically through small revival attempts—none truly successful—until Volkswagen acquired the rights in 1998.

Piëch’s decision to bring Bugatti back wasn’t just nostalgia—it was a deliberate move to create a halo car for the entire VW Group, showcasing what its engineers could do without budgetary constraints. The mission was clear: build the fastest, most powerful, and most advanced production car ever conceived.

When the Veyron finally debuted, it immediately captured the world’s attention. It wasn’t just the performance figures that made headlines; it was the way Bugatti combined such speed with refinement. This was a car you could drive across Europe in comfort—and then take to a test track to break the 250 mph barrier.

The Veyron’s resurgence was also symbolic. The car was assembled in Molsheim, France, at a modern facility built alongside the restored historic Bugatti buildings, bringing production back to the company’s spiritual home. It was as much a revival of Bugatti’s heritage as it was a technological revolution.


Striking Design – More Than Just Looks

At first glance, the Veyron’s design is polarizing. It doesn’t have the aggressive wedge of a Lamborghini or the flowing elegance of a Ferrari; instead, it’s a sculptural blend of curves, aerodynamics, and functional design. The two-tone paintwork is instantly recognizable, and while the car appears compact in photos, in person it feels wide, planted, and muscular.

The exterior is a blend of carbon fiber, aluminum, and stainless steel, designed to be as aerodynamic as possible while maintaining stability at extreme speeds. The front end features massive air intakes to feed the radiators and intercoolers, while the rear incorporates an active spoiler that adjusts height and angle depending on speed and braking force.

Interestingly, the engine isn’t completely hidden—it sits proudly exposed between two large intake snorkels, a decision made partly for cooling purposes and partly to showcase the mechanical marvel within. This functional yet dramatic approach echoes the Bugatti philosophy: beauty through engineering.

Classic Bugatti models like the Type 57 and the Atlantic coupe were never conventionally “pretty” in the traditional sense, but they commanded attention and admiration. The Veyron follows that tradition. It may take time for some to appreciate its aesthetics, but once you see it in motion—or hear that W16 roar—you understand its allure.

The Beating Heart – W16 Quad-Turbocharged Engine

The centerpiece of the Veyron is its 8.0-liter W16 engine, a layout unlike anything else on the road. Effectively two narrow-angle V8 engines joined at the crankshaft, the W16 is force-fed by four turbochargers, delivering 1,001 horsepower at 6,000 rpm and an earth-moving 922 lb-ft of torque between 2,200 and 5,500 rpm.

Cooling such a massive power unit is a challenge in itself. The Veyron uses 10 radiators for various systems, including engine cooling, oil, and air conditioning. At full throttle, the engine produces so much heat that it could boil water in minutes—hence the need for such an elaborate thermal management system.

All this power would be useless without control, and that’s where Bugatti’s engineering brilliance shines. The engine’s power delivery is smooth yet relentless, pulling with equal ferocity from a standstill or at 200 mph. The turbos spool almost instantly, eliminating lag and ensuring seamless acceleration.

Rumors suggest early Veyrons often produced more than the claimed 1,001 horsepower—sometimes closer to 1,100—making their performance figures even more impressive.

Transmission & Drivetrain – Harnessing the Beast

Putting 1,001 horsepower to the ground is no simple task. Bugatti equipped the Veyron with a specially developed seven-speed dual-clutch DSG gearbox, capable of shifting in just 0.15 seconds. Power is split between all four wheels via a Haldex all-wheel-drive system, ensuring maximum traction in any condition.

Launch control is a spectacle in itself. Engage the system, floor the accelerator, and the revs stabilize at 3,000 rpm. Release the brake, and the Veyron rockets to 60 mph in just 2.7 seconds, with no wheelspin—just an unrelenting surge forward.

The drivetrain isn’t just about speed; it’s also about stability. At higher speeds, the car’s active suspension lowers the ride height, while the rear wing adjusts for downforce. The system can even switch to a special “Top Speed Mode” when the driver uses a dedicated key, reducing drag and allowing the car to hit its maximum velocity of 253 mph.


Inside the Cockpit – Luxury Meets Futurism

Stepping into the cabin of the 2006 Bugatti Veyron 16.4 feels like entering a blend of a high-fashion boutique and a spacecraft. Every surface is crafted from the finest materials—hand-stitched leather, Alcantara, polished aluminum, and engine-turned metal accents. Bugatti didn’t just build a speed machine; they built a luxury grand tourer that could comfortably ferry its occupants at triple-digit speeds for hours on end.

The interior’s design language draws inspiration from the 1930s, paying homage to Bugatti’s golden era while integrating modern technology. The center console is minimalist yet elegant, with aluminum switchgear and a vertically oriented control stack. There’s no clutter—just functional beauty.

The most striking feature in the cockpit is the 1,001-horsepower power dial located on the instrument cluster’s lower left side. Unlike a traditional tachometer, it visually reminds the driver of the monumental force under their right foot. Other gauges are laid out with precision, giving the driver all necessary information without overwhelming them.

Seating is snug but not confining, offering ample support for high-speed stability while remaining comfortable for long-distance drives. The pedals are slightly offset to the right—a quirk of packaging the enormous drivetrain—but quickly become second nature.

Practicality is minimal (just 1.9 cubic feet of luggage space), but that’s hardly the point. The Veyron’s cabin is about immersion—every texture, every surface, every control exists to heighten the sense of occasion. Whether cruising at 80 mph or rocketing past 200 mph, the interior remains calm, quiet, and insulated from the chaos outside.

This is a supercar that doesn’t punish its driver. Instead, it pampers them with an environment that blends artisanal craftsmanship with the precision of aerospace engineering. For all its outrageous performance, the Veyron never forgets that it’s still a Bugatti—refined, sophisticated, and timeless.

Acceleration – Defying Physics

Numbers alone can’t fully convey the Veyron’s acceleration experience, but let’s try. Zero to 60 mph? 2.7 seconds. The quarter-mile? 10.4 seconds at nearly 140 mph. And it does this without drama—no wheelspin, no frantic corrections—just relentless, linear thrust.

Part of what makes this acceleration so astonishing is the way the Veyron sustains it. Most cars, even supercars, experience a noticeable taper in acceleration as speeds climb. The Veyron simply doesn’t. Past 150 mph, it’s still accelerating with the same ferocity as it did from 50 to 100 mph.

The sensation is so alien that it challenges your perception of speed. At 200 mph, you’d expect chaos—wind noise, vibration, instability—but in the Veyron, it feels almost serene. The active suspension lowers the car, the rear wing fine-tunes its angle, and the aerodynamic balance locks the car onto the road like it’s riding on invisible rails.

Much of this is possible thanks to its all-wheel-drive system and perfectly matched Michelin PAX tires, designed specifically for the Veyron. These tires are engineered to handle not only the immense power but also the extreme heat generated at sustained high speeds.

Drivers often describe the experience as “teleportation.” One moment, the horizon is comfortably distant; the next, it’s rushing toward you like a scene from a sci-fi movie. Your body is pressed into the seat, your vision narrows, and the world becomes a blur—yet inside the cabin, you remain composed, secure, and in control.

In an age where acceleration numbers are constantly being shattered by electric hypercars, the Veyron still holds its mystique because it delivers that performance with a W16 symphony, a mechanical heartbeat that no battery pack can replicate.


Top Speed – The 253 MPH Club

The Veyron’s headline figure—253 mph—wasn’t just a marketing stunt; it was verified on Volkswagen’s Ehra-Lessien test track. But achieving that speed requires more than just raw power. The Veyron transforms itself aerodynamically in Top Speed Mode, accessible only after inserting a special key.

Once engaged, the car lowers itself by 0.8 inches, the rear wing retracts to reduce drag, and the front air diffusers close. Every change is designed to cheat the wind and maximize stability at velocities where aerodynamic forces can become violent.

Even so, hitting 253 mph is something very few people will ever experience. Outside of a purpose-built track, there’s simply no safe environment for such speeds. On public roads, the Veyron is electronically limited to 233 mph—a figure that still dwarfs almost every other production car.

At these extreme velocities, the forces at play are staggering. Air resistance alone demands over 270 horsepower to overcome at 150 mph—and the Veyron must fight nearly four times that at its top speed. This is why the car’s cooling and aerodynamic systems are so critical; without them, sustaining such speeds would be impossible.

And yet, what’s perhaps most remarkable is how composed the car feels. Test drivers have reported that even at over 240 mph, the steering remains precise, the chassis stable, and the car entirely predictable. That level of refinement at such speed is what separates the Veyron from other “top speed” machines—it isn’t just about the number, it’s about the experience of getting there.

Braking – Bringing a Missile to a Stop

Going fast is one thing; stopping from those speeds is another challenge entirely. The Veyron’s braking system is as advanced as its powertrain, featuring massive carbon-ceramic discs—15.8 inches at the front, 15 inches at the rear—paired with eight-piston calipers.

From 60 mph, the Veyron stops in just 103 feet—an astonishing feat for a car weighing 4,530 pounds. From 100 mph, it halts in 293 feet. This is made possible not only by the braking hardware but also by the car’s active aerodynamics.

Above 120 mph, pressing the brake pedal deploys the rear wing into an “airbrake” position, standing at a 55-degree angle to create enormous drag and increase downforce on the rear tires. This aerodynamic assist adds stability while reducing braking distances.

In normal driving, the brakes feel progressive and easy to modulate—there’s no sudden bite that could unsettle the car. But when used in anger, they deliver supercar-level deceleration that pins you against the seatbelts just as fiercely as acceleration pushes you into the seat.

This balance between speed and stopping power reinforces the Veyron’s status as a complete performance machine. It’s not just about going faster than anything else—it’s about doing so safely, repeatedly, and with confidence.

Handling – The Surprising Agility of a 4,530-Pound Rocket

When you first hear the Veyron’s curb weight—over two tons—you might assume it handles like a luxury GT rather than a razor-sharp supercar. But Bugatti’s engineers worked tirelessly to ensure this wasn’t the case. The Veyron can pull 0.96 g in corners, thanks to its advanced suspension, ultra-wide tires, and all-wheel-drive system.

The suspension is a masterpiece of engineering. Both front and rear use control arms with coil springs and hydraulic ride-height adjustment, allowing the car to adapt its posture based on speed and driving mode. In normal conditions, the Veyron rides with surprising comfort, soaking up imperfections in the road. Switch to handling mode, however, and the chassis drops, stiffens, and becomes far more responsive.

The steering feel is on the lighter side, drawing some comparisons to Audi’s hydraulic setups, but it’s precise and quick. The car’s massive footprint provides incredible stability, making it easy to place on the road despite its power. Around tight bends, it remains neutral and composed, with minimal understeer—an impressive feat for such a heavy car.

The figure-eight test, which combines braking, acceleration, and cornering, revealed the Veyron’s dual personality. It’s equally at home blasting down a straight as it is carving through high-speed sweepers. This blend of high-speed stability and low-speed agility is rare, and it makes the Veyron not just a numbers car, but an engaging driver’s machine.

While it doesn’t have the feather-light touch of a Lotus Elise, the Veyron offers something more—confidence. You can push it harder than you’d ever imagine, and it responds without drama. It may be a land rocket, but it’s one you can truly drive.


Engineering Masterpiece – Building the Impossible

Creating the Bugatti Veyron was less about incremental improvement and more about redefining what was possible in automotive engineering. Ferdinand Piëch’s challenge to his team—1,000 horsepower, over 250 mph, and everyday usability—meant they had to invent new solutions for nearly every component.

For example, the tires had to be specially designed by Michelin to withstand the forces and heat generated at over 250 mph. They feature unique construction and compounds, and replacing a set is an expensive endeavor—often costing more than a brand-new compact car.

The transmission had to handle the immense torque without delay, leading to the development of one of the most advanced dual-clutch systems ever built. The cooling system required 10 radiators, each with a specific role, to keep temperatures in check. Even the aerodynamics are active, adjusting automatically for drag reduction or downforce depending on speed.

The chassis blends carbon fiber, aluminum, and stainless steel for maximum strength with minimal weight. The central monocoque is carbon-fiber, while the subframes are aluminum. This combination ensures rigidity without sacrificing performance.

In many ways, the Veyron was a technological moonshot, much like sending a spacecraft into orbit. The team didn’t just meet the challenge—they exceeded it, creating a car that remains relevant and revered nearly two decades later.


Bugatti Heritage – From Ettore to the Veyron

To understand the Veyron’s significance, you need to appreciate the history behind the Bugatti name. Founded in 1909 by Ettore Bugatti, the company quickly became known for producing elegant, high-performance cars that combined artistry with engineering brilliance. Models like the Type 35 race car and the Type 57SC Atlantic became legends in the automotive world.

But after Ettore’s death in 1947, Bugatti struggled. Attempts to revive the brand in the 1950s and 1960s failed, and the company faded into obscurity. In the early 1990s, entrepreneur Romano Artioli launched the EB110—a quad-turbo V12 supercar that hinted at Bugatti’s potential—but financial troubles ended the project.

Volkswagen’s acquisition of Bugatti in 1998 marked a turning point. Dr. Piëch’s vision was not just to restore the brand’s reputation but to create a car so advanced it would dominate the supercar world for years to come. Building it in Molsheim, the brand’s original home, added authenticity to the revival.

The Veyron became the ultimate expression of Bugatti’s heritage—engineering excellence, luxury, and exclusivity. It honored Ettore’s philosophy of building “the best car in the world” while pushing the limits of what a modern automobile could be.


Ownership Experience – The Cost of Perfection

Owning a Veyron is not for the faint of heart—or wallet. The base price in 2006 was $1,440,800, but maintenance costs are equally jaw-dropping. An oil change can run into five figures, and a full set of tires can cost upwards of $25,000.

But owners aren’t buying the Veyron for practicality; they’re buying it for the experience. Driving one is an event, whether you’re cruising through a city or unleashing its power on an open stretch of road. The car draws attention everywhere it goes, from car enthusiasts to people who know nothing about automobiles—everyone recognizes it as something extraordinary.

Service and maintenance are handled by a network of specialized technicians, many of whom travel to the owner’s location. The level of care is more akin to that of a private jet than a conventional car. This white-glove approach ensures that each Veyron remains in peak condition, both mechanically and aesthetically.

For collectors, the Veyron has proven to be a solid investment. Its historical significance and limited production numbers have helped it maintain—and in some cases increase—its value over time. In the supercar world, it’s as much a status symbol as it is a performance benchmark.
